Scripture References

Occurrences in the Bible

3 total references
ReferenceText
Acts 19:24

For a certain man named Demetrius, a silversmith, which made silver shrines for Diana, brought no small gain unto the craftsmen;

Word: Δημήτριος (Dēmḗtrios)
Acts 19:38

Wherefore if Demetrius, and the craftsmen which are with him, have a matter against any man, the law is open, and there are deputies: let them implead one another.

Word: Δημήτριος (Dēmḗtrios)
3 John 1:12

Demetrius hath good report of all men, and of the truth itself: yea, and we also bear record; and ye know that our record is true.
